What you will be doing:
- Conducting Occupational Health Assessment and provide evidence-based advice to employers and employees
- Undertake case management for a range of health issues, including fitness for work, workplace adjustments and return to work planning
- Conducting consultations, that combine clarity of thought and support to the referring managers and employee.
- Provide clear, concise and professional reports for employers, outlining medical opinions and recommendations
- Liaise with employers, HR teams and other healthcare professionals to support employee wellbeing and organisational health goals
What we're looking for:
- A qualified and experienced Occupational Health Physician (DOccMed/MFOM/FFOM).
- At least three years of clinical experience in occupational health and safety critical referrals.
- Rail and pensions experience desirable.
- Strong clinical knowledge and experience in occupational health, including case management, workplace assessments, and health surveillance.
- Excellent communication skills and the ability to build trusted relationships with clients and colleagues.
- A proactive and solution-focused approach to occupational health challenges combined with strong organisational and time management skills.
- Familiarity with relevant workplace health legislation and guidelines (e.g. Equality Act, Health & Safety at Work Act).
